Post content
📊Complete SQL Syllabus Roadmap (Beginner to Expert)🗄️ 🔰Beginner Level: 1. Intro to Databases: What are databases, Relational vs. Non-Relational 2. SQL Basics: SELECT, FROM, WHERE 3. Data Types: INT, VARCHAR, DATE, BOOLEAN, etc. 4. Operators: Comparison, Logical (AND, OR, NOT) 5. Sorting & Filtering: ORDER BY, LIMIT, DISTINCT 6. Aggregate Functions: COUNT, SUM, AVG, MIN, MAX 7. GROUP BY and HAVING: Grouping Data and Filtering Groups 8. Basic Projects: Creating and querying a simple database (e.g., a student database) ⚙️Intermediate Level: 1. Joins: INNER, LEFT, RIGHT, FULL OUTER JOIN 2. Subqueries: Using queries within queries 3. Indexes: Improving Query Performance 4. Data Modification: INSERT, UPDATE, DELETE 5. Transactions: ACID Properties, COMMIT, ROLLBACK 6. Constraints: PRIMARY KEY, FOREIGN KEY, UNIQUE, NOT NULL, CHECK, DEFAULT 7. Views: Creating Virtual Tables 8. Stored Procedures & Functions: Reusable SQL Code 9. Date and Time Functions: Working with Date and Time Data 10. Intermediate Projects: Designing and querying a more complex database (e.g., an e-commerce database) 🏆Expert Level: 1. Window Functions: RANK, ROW_NUMBER, LAG, LEAD 2. Common Table Expressions (CTEs): Recursive and Non-Recursive 3. Performance Tuning: Query Optimization Techniques 4. Database Design & Normalization: Understanding Database Schemas (Star, Snowflake) 5. Advanced Indexing: Clustered, Non-Clustered, Filtered Indexes 6. Database Administration: Backup and Recovery, Security, User Management 7. Working with Large Datasets: Partitioning, Data Warehousing Concepts 8. NoSQL Databases: Introduction to MongoDB, Cassandra, etc. (optional) 9. SQL Injection Prevention: Secure Coding Practices 10. Expert Projects: Designing, optimizing, and managing a large-scale database (e.g., a social media database) 💡Bonus: Learn about Database Security, Cloud Databases (AWS RDS, Azure SQL Database, Google Cloud SQL), and Data Modeling Tools. 👍Tap ❤️ for more